Difficult to say for sure. There's so many factors which potentially influence battery life. I think ultimately, it's an e-bike. Just use the mode that suits your need/mood at the time -feck the rest - enjoy it

. Trying different usage techniques will probably have little overall influence on life span in the scheme of things. Even when you run it "flat" they're designed so they're not actually "flat". The main thing is just not leaving it fully charged if it's going to sit for any reasonable length of time.
In general I just fully charge after every ride, but then it's normally flat or nearly flat.
